The Japan Commercial Banking Market is characterized by a highly competitive landscape dominated by major players such as Mitsubishi UFJ Financial Group, Sumitomo Mitsui Financial Group, and Mizuho Financial Group. These banks offer a wide range of financial products and services to businesses, including corporate loans, trade finance, cash management, and investment banking. The market is heavily regulated by the Financial Services Agency to ensure stability and protect consumer interests. With a strong focus on innovation and technology, Japanese commercial banks are increasingly investing in digital banking solutions to enhance customer experience and streamline operations. The market is also witnessing a growing trend towards sustainable finance and ESG (Environmental, Social, and Governance) initiatives as businesses prioritize responsible and ethical practices.

In the Japan Commercial Banking Market, several challenges are prevalent. One major challenge is the low interest rate environment, which has been ongoing for an extended period, squeezing banks` net interest margins and profitability. Additionally, the market is highly competitive with many domestic and international players vying for market share, putting pressure on banks to differentiate their services and attract customers. Regulatory requirements are also stringent, leading to increased compliance costs and operational complexities. Moreover, the aging population and decreasing birth rates in Japan pose a challenge in terms of limited growth opportunities and changing customer demographics. Adapting to digital transformation and technological advancements while maintaining customer trust and data security further add to the challenges faced by commercial banks in Japan.

The Japanese government has implemented various policies to regulate and support the commercial banking market in the country. One key policy is the Financial Services Agency (FSA) overseeing banking regulations to ensure stability and transparency in the industry. Additionally, the Bank of Japan plays a crucial role in setting monetary policies that impact commercial banks` operations, such as interest rates and liquidity measures. The government also promotes competition and innovation in the banking sector through initiatives like the Financial Market Entry Consultation Desk, which assists foreign banks in entering the Japanese market. Overall, these policies aim to maintain a sound and competitive commercial banking sector in Japan while safeguarding the interests of consumers and promoting economic growth.
